IN10 joins Handpicked

Breda, 17 June 2021

Rotterdam-based design & innovation agency IN10 joins forces with Brabant-based Handpicked. Together, they form a group of eight specialised digital agencies, with a team of more than 230 specialists. By combining their strengths, they enhance both specialized and integrated services, assisting clients in accelerating their digital transformation.

More power in strategy and design

Handpicked, recently named best agency group in the Netherlands in the Emerce100, works as a family of specialised digital agencies for clients such as Nespresso, Brabantia, Sligro, Nationale Nederlanden, CZ and Ziggo.

Rob Peters, partner Handpicked: “The addition of IN10 to the group results in a significant strengthening of our capabilities in strategy and design. The management of IN10, Xander Zuidgeest, Arno Wolterman and Bjorn Stolte, are joining Handpicked Holding but will continue to manage IN10 on a daily basis. Bjorn will also work on enhancing and strengthening the integrated services provided to clients from within the group.

The merger fits well with the changing needs of clients, according to Peters: “As brands and organisations mature digitally, they also build high-quality digital teams in-house. This shifts the demand towards agencies from full service to what we call full specialism. A primary reinforcement and acceleration from specialists, but from a smart integrated strategy. With IN10, we can now offer that combination at the highest level."

More execution power for IN10

IN10 has an extensive track record in accelerating digital innovation through strategy and design. The agency works with clients such as the Anne Frank Foundation, NPO, Boymans, Municipality of Rotterdam, NOC*NSF, The Greenery, Port of Rotterdam and Laurens Zorg. Together, they focus on developing rich digital customer journeys and innovating digital products and services. Based on the mission 'design for positive change', IN10 pays close attention to the impact of digital transformation on people and planet. IN10's work has been honoured with national and international awards.

Bjorn Stolte, Partner IN10: “Due to our focus on strategy and design, our execution power on technology and data-driven marketing has been limited so far. We are very excited about Handpicked's vision and craftsmanship in these domains. Together, we can now offer our clients more specialist knowledge and strength. Not from one mega agency, but from a collective of specialists driven by entrepreneurship, specialist craftsmanship and impact.”

Three locations in the Netherlands

The location of IN10 at Hofplein in Rotterdam is now also a hub for the specialists from the other Handpicked agencies.  A number of these agencies will eventually also establish themselves here. Peters: "With this, Handpicked is physically making its debut in the Randstad. With our other existing locations in Breda and Eindhoven, this brings the number of Handpicked locations to three. These will be used by the combined teams and clients on the basis of 'Activity Based Working'. This strengthens Handpicked's position as a national player, which is also beneficial for clients and employees."

About Handpicked

Handpicked is a group of digital agencies that started operating under this name in 2018, but originated as E-sites in 1999. In total, there are eight agencies, each utilising their own speciality, identity and strength: Bluebird Day (e-commerce), Boldly (AR and VR experiences), E-sites (web and mobile development), Fingerspitz (online marketing), IN10 (strategy, design & innovation), TDE (digital sports marketing), Twentyseven (.net enterprise technology and digital transformations) and Weekend (branding, design & creative impact). The agencies work intensively together for many clients, including: Brabantia, Bruynzeel kitchens, Ziggo Sport & Sligro. Handpicked is based in Breda, Eindhoven and Rotterdam and has 230 employees.
